Sierra Providence East Medical Opens

New State-of-the-Art Wound Care and Hyperbaric Medicine Center

Sierra Providence East Medical Center (SPEMC) is expanding with the opening of a new Wound Care and Hyperbaric Medicine Center. The state-of-the-art 3474 square foot facility located in the medical office building next to the hospital will offer specialized treatment for chronic or non-healing wounds, which are defined as sores or wounds that have not significantly improved from conventional treatments.

“The Wound Care and Hyperbaric Centerrepresentsover a quarter of a million dollar investment by Sierra Providence East Medical Center, and offers a much needed service to our physicians and patients. We are extremely excited about the opportunity to continue to meet the healthcare needs of our ever-growing eastside community", said Sally Hurt-Steffen, CEO of Sierra Providence East Medical Center.

The oxygenation offered by hyperbaric treatments canhelp patients with chronic non-healing wounds caused by diabetes, traumatic injury, poor circulation, radiation treatment and other causes. The center has two private hyperbaric chambers that can provide a relaxing treatment setting. It allows patients to watch a movie or even listen to music. This specific type of care involves giving patients high concentrations of oxygen under pressure to increase the oxygen level in the blood and tissues to promote healing.

“The primary goal of the center will be to provide the best possible patient outcomes by working closely with our multi-disciplinary team. We will be offering integrated treatments with exceptional customer service all while having the latest technology available in the region”, added Alex Macias, Wound Care and Hyperbaric Center Director.

The Wound Care Center works with physicians to determine effective courses of treatment. This comprehensive outpatient service offers advanced healing therapies often unavailable in primary care offices. These services use a variety of therapies and techniques, including debridement, hyperbaric oxygen therapy, dressing selection, special shoes, and patient education. When wounds persist and resist conventional treatment, a specialized approach is required for healing.
